In the heart-stopping sixth week of the Mansfield Tuesday 6-a-side Football League, teams from Division 1 and Division 2 clashed with spectacular energy, providing spectators with a feast of football finesse.

In the elite Division 1, the Eagles soared to victory with a resounding 9-1 win over Who Dummet. The dominant display saw their strikers relentlessly attacking the goal post, proving to be a tough match for their opponents. Their top scorer's powerful shots and nimble footwork left spectators in awe, making it a night to remember for the Eagles.

Elsewhere in Division 1, Ingerland claimed a crucial win over O.B. City, with a final scoreline of 5-3. The match was a thrilling end-to-end affair with Ingerland's top scorer's hat trick being the talk of the evening.

Division 2 witnessed equally exciting action, with FC Patrol falling 5-2 to a determined Bleeding Blue. Despite the tough loss, FC Patrol’s fighting spirit was apparent throughout the match. Bleeding Blue’s top scorer was on fire, netting a stunning hat-trick to seal their win.

Sutton United whitewashed Pathetico Madrid with an emphatic 5-0 scoreline, proving their superiority in the division. Their top scorer’s impressive performance was a highlight of the match, contributing significantly to their victory.

Skegby United triumphed against Sevilla Autism with a scoreline of 5-2, while Ball Of Duty dominated Expected ToulouseFC with a commanding 8-1 victory. The breathtaking performances of the top scorers from both winning teams were the high points of these encounters.
